Highlights of the Preclinical Study
The latest data, derived from preclinical studies of the lead T-cell engager candidate, HCW11-018b, showcased its powerful capabilities. This exciting second-generation TCE product is designed to target a broad spectrum of solid tumors, providing high potency and precision as demonstrated in xenograft models.
Unique Features of the T-Cell Engager Program
Some of the standout features of HCW's TCE program include:
- Broad coverage for human solid tumor indications, specifically targeting tissue factor.
- A tetra-valent construct that effectively addresses the immunosuppressive tumor microenvironment.
- Fingers into tumor-infiltrated exhausted T cells for enhanced immune response activation.
- A favorable tolerability profile observed in non-human primate studies at dosing levels exceeding the efficacious threshold.
- An extended serum half-life and ideal pharmacokinetics, achieved without conventional fusion technologies.
- A streamlined Good Manufacturing Practice (GMP) process akin to monoclonal antibody production.
- Subcutaneous administration route aiming to boost patient safety and quality of life.
Expert Insights on the Research
Dr. Hing C. Wong, the esteemed Founder and CEO of HCW Biologics, expressed his enthusiasm regarding the preclinical results which indicated that HCW11-018b could effectively reduce tumor sizes in established xenograft models. Remarkably, all treated tumor-bearing mice demonstrated survival, contrasting sharply with the untreated cohort. This success opens avenues for enhancing treatment protocols for patients facing a range of solid tumors, where the focus is on critical cases like pancreatic cancer and glioblastoma.
